Abstract

A ruled real hypersurface in a complex space form is a real hypersurface having a codimension one foliation by totally geodesic complex hyperplanes of the ambient space. Our main purpose of this paper is to introduce a new viewpoint to investigate such hypersurfaces in complex hyperbolic space \(\mathbb {CH}^n\). As an application, we study minimal ruled real hypersurfaces in \(\mathbb {CH}^n\) and also those having constant scalar curvature.
